Cape May — Cape May, on the Jersey shore, was America’s first seaside resort, at one time rivaling Newport, Rhode Island, in class and status. Now it’s the laid-back vacation spot of choice for young families, East Coast honeymooners, and those seeking an easy sun-and-surf summer getaway. Although not as popular in the winter, weekends draw couples from nearby New York City and Washington, D.C., with the promise of a relaxing escape spent curled up by a fire in a cozy, Victorian-era B&B.
